Review : Sigur Ros – Með suð í eyrum við spilum endalaust

Með suð í eyrum við spilum endalaust

Með suð í eyrum við spilum endalaust (in english – with a buzz in our ears we play endlessly) is the fifth full length album from Sigur Ros and is released on 23rd June in the UK.

For the first time, they have drafted in some outside production talent and enlisted Flood (Depeche Mode, U2) the wiggle the faders.

On the opening two tracks ‘Gobbledigook’ and ‘Inní mér syngur vitleysingur’ there is a more progressive, jumpy up and down style from Sigur Ros which really works. Its a euphoric opening to an album which will draw comparisons with Arcade Fire.

Track 5 is marvellous ‘Festival’ starting off with 4 or 5 minutes of the Sigur Ros everyone recognises, gentle vocals and ethereal sounds before building to a climax complete with horns, guitars, fearsome drums and cymbals – it is both brutal and beautiful and compelling listening…right down the feint whistling on the outro as the melody repeats.

Með suð í eyrum’ – is a nice quiet interlude, with a rolling drum line & gentle piano – before my favourite track on the album – ‘Ára bátur’ (rowing boat?) arrives, a  Sigur Ros epic, just shy of nine minutes opening with just a piano and Jonsi’s vocal, including his voice cracking and straining, but by the time the track ends there are more than 90 people involved in the track, including the London Oratory and the London Sinfonietta with the choir and the strings adding layers of depth I’ve not seen before with a Sigur Ros track. It really is a masterpiece – and I think we’ll hear this one for many years to come played over sunrises and sports celebrations as TV music.

The album closes out with ‘All Alright’ which to my knowledge is the first time that Sigur Ros have recorded in English.

It is definitely a good progression from ( ) and Takk and SIgur Ros have produced a really compelling album, full of texture and detail but accessible enough that they will discover new fans.  Hvarf/Heim plugged the gap between releases – but this is the real deal – buy it now, you won’t be disappointed.
